BEREA, OHIO -- The Baldwin Wallace University wrestling team finished third of five teams at the 24th Annual John Summa Memorial Tournament in the Lou Higgins Center Fieldhouse today (Saturday, February 6, 2010). Two Yellow Jackets won individual titles and three BW grapplers placed second.
Brockport State (N.Y.) won the team title for the 14th straight year with a total of 167.50 points. Waynesburg (Pa.) University placed second with 139.50 points, host BW was third with 134, Thiel (Pa.) College was fourth with 54 and Rochester (N.Y.) Institute of Technology was fifth with 35.50 points. Waynesburg's 125-pounder Alex Crown was the 2010 John Summa Most Valuable Wrestler, BW junior 125-pounder Tyler Erwin (Westerville/ Watkins Memorial) had the Fastest Pin in 36 seconds and won the award for the Most Pins in the Least Amount of Time with two in 2:37. The only 2009 champion to defed a title this year was Brockport's James Forsyth, who won the title at 149 pounds a year ago and won the 165-pound crown in 2010.
